# What Is a Pancake Induction Coil and Its Uses?

A pancake induction coil is an electromagnetic device widely recognized for its efficiency in various applications, particularly in heating and induction cooking processes. Its design comprises a flat, circular coil that delivers a strong magnetic field, making it a preferred choice for numerous industrial and household purposes.

## Understanding the Basics of a Pancake Induction Coil.

### What Makes Up a Pancake Induction Coil?

A pancake induction coil is typically constructed from copper wire wound into a flat, spiral shape. This design allows for the generation of a uniform magnetic field when an alternating current (AC) runs through it. Here are the primary components involved:

- **Copper Wire**: The conductors used to create the coil.

- **Insulation Material**: Prevents short circuits and ensures the coil's safety.

- **Core Material** (optional): Enhances the magnetic properties, depending on the application.

### How Does It Work?

The operation of a pancake induction coil is based on the principle of electromagnetic induction. When AC passes through the coil, it generates an oscillating magnetic field. This magnetic field can induce currents in nearby conductive materials, leading to heating effects or magnetic interactions essential for various processes.

## Practical Applications of Pancake Induction Coils.

Pancake induction coils are versatile, and their applications span various industries. Some key uses include:

### Induction Heating.

- **Metalworking**: Used to heat metal components for forging, hardening, or melting.

- **Cooking**: In induction cooktops, these coils heat pots and pans directly, providing efficient cooking solutions.

### Electromagnetic Field Generation.

- **Research & Development**: Employed in experiments requiring controlled electromagnetic fields.

- **Industrial Sensors**: Used in devices that detect metal objects or measure material properties.

### Wireless Power Transfer.

- **Charging Systems**: Used in wireless charging stations for electronic devices, allowing for contactless energy transfer.

## Common Problems and Solutions.

Despite their advantages, users may encounter issues when working with pancake induction coils. Here are some common problems and practical suggestions:

### Problem: Inconsistent Heating.

- **Solution**: Ensure the coil is correctly tuned to the frequency of the power source. Use a frequency generator to achieve the ideal resonance.

### Problem: Overheating of the Coil.

- **Solution**: Implement proper cooling methods. Cooling fans or heat sinks can help maintain a stable temperature.

### Problem: Poor Induction Efficiency.

- **Solution**: Assess the coil's alignment with the workpiece; they should be as close as possible without making contact. Additionally, check for any insulation damage.
